What strikes most about Japanese artist Tetsuya Umeda’s work, is his wildly imaginative and inventive way with objects, using low-level technology approach. In his hands, the objects like tine cans, buckets, light bulbs start a life on their own, regardless their traditional purpose. To experience his installations is like entering a science lab with a busy professor – Umeda playfully orchestrates not only objects, but also natural phenomenas. Here water evaporating or smoke rising will generate a string of actions, gradually building delicate and rich environments where the human is a witness and collaborator, but never the one in control.

In Riga, Umeda will create a durational concert-installation using 50 empty rice cans. The creation of sound by heating the cans dates 2000 years back to ancient Japanese ritual where this was a way of telling the future and the sound was believed to be the voice of god.

International Festival of Contemporary Theatre "Homo Novus" is the leading performing arts festival in Latvia and one of the biggest in the Baltic region. Festival takes place in Riga from September 5 till 13, 2019 and introduces audiences to both new and renowned artists that seek ways of expressing their views and opinions about the world and the society. Festival offers a range of performances as well as seminars, workshops and other activities.
